Peoria, IL – In a violent late-night incident on Wednesday, May 8, 2024, Peoria Police rushed to the 800 block of W. Thrush Avenue following alerts of 38 rounds being fired, as detected by the Shot Spotter system. An adult male was seriously injured in the shooting and was taken to a local hospital by a private vehicle. The gunfire occurred inside a residence, resulting in serious injuries to the victim.

Peoria Police Department officials stated that units from the Criminal Investigations Division, Crime Scene Unit, and Patrol Unit are actively investigating the scene, where multiple shell casings were found outside the residence. Currently, there are no suspects, and the investigation is ongoing. The police are appealing to the public for any information related to this shooting or other violent crimes.
